Information We Collect

When you use the BetterPrice Chrome extension, it reads basic product information from the pages you visit — specifically product title, price, brand (when available), and the page URL — in order to find cheaper alternatives on Amazon. We strip query parameters from URLs before they reach our servers, keeping only product identifiers (sku, product_id, etc.) on a strict allowlist. We do not collect your name, email, payment details, browsing history, or any data from non-product pages. The extension only activates on pre-approved e-commerce sites; on other sites, you must click the extension icon to activate it manually.

Match Quality Reports

If you click the small flag icon on a product card to report a mismatch, we record the ASIN, the reason you selected, and a one-way hashed version of your IP address (used only to prevent spam, never to identify you). These reports help us improve matching and block bad results. Reports do not contain any personally identifying information.

How We Use Your Data

Product data collected by the extension is used to (1) find matching products on Amazon via Amazon's Product Advertising API and a third-party Amazon data provider, (2) display price comparison results to you, (3) build our database of public price comparison pages on betterprice.io, and (4) improve our matching algorithms via aggregated, anonymized analytics. We cache exchange rates and product lookups for up to one hour to reduce duplicate calls.

Data Sharing

We do not sell your personal data. Product comparison data may be displayed publicly on betterprice.io/compare pages (showing the store URL with PII stripped, product name, brand, and prices). We do not include any personally identifying information on these pages. We use Supabase as our data storage provider; their privacy practices are governed by their own privacy policy. We send product titles and ASINs to Amazon (via the Product Advertising API) and to a third-party Amazon data provider in order to fetch prices and availability.

Security

Requests from the extension to our servers are signed with HMAC-SHA256 to verify they originate from a real BetterPrice extension instance. This is a server-integrity measure, not a personal-data measure — it does not identify users. We use HTTPS for all data in transit. Stored data is hosted with Supabase on managed infrastructure with industry-standard access controls.
